发明名称 ANALYTICAL MODEL FOR PREDICTING CURRENT MISMATCH IN METAL OXIDE SEMICONDUCTOR ARRAYS
摘要 A system and method for designing integrated circuits and predicting current mismatch in a metal oxide semiconductor (MOS) array. A first subset of cells in the MOS array is selected and current measured for each of these cells. Standard deviation of current for each cell in the first subset of cells is determined with respect to current of a reference cell. Standard deviation of local variation can be determined using the determined standard deviation of current for one or more cells in the first subset. Standard deviations of variation induced by, for example, poly density gradient effects, in the x and/or y direction of the array can then be determined and current mismatch for any cell in the array determined therefrom.

主权项 1. A method of characterizing an array in an IC, comprising the steps of: forming an array of cells having a set of cells on a substrate; measuring current for each cell in a first subset of the set of cells; determining a variance of current for each cell in the first subset of cells with respect to current of a reference cell in the array; determining local variance of current for one or more cells in the first subset of cells; using a processor to calculate variance of current due to a poly density gradient effect in a first direction based on the determined local variance of current and the determined variance of current with respect to the reference cell in the first subset of cells; and using the processor to calculate a current mismatch of another cell of the array from the determined local variance and the calculated variance of current due to the poly density gradient effect in the first direction, said another cell being excluded from the first subset of cells.
